Covinil is a flexible packaging film manufacturer, specialised in the candy twist-wrap market. Covinil’s films, commercialised under the trademark CECRONIL, include polyolefin based materials, CPP and CPP twist (special film for candy wrap), as well as other plastic materials such as PVC. These twist-wrap films are all approved for food contact, have excellent twist properties and twist retention, and achieve excellent results in all kinds of twist wrapping machines used in the confectionery industry. Covinil’s PVC films are also widely used for the manufacture of different products in the Christmas decoration market. COVINIL, S.A. has a laboratory equipped with measuring and testing machines and instruments, to determine both physical and chemical characteristics, allowing analysing manufacturing processes and finished products. These tests complement the process control systems of the production lines. Laboratory tests include: gas chromatography, mechanical, optical, electrical, thermal and of barrier properties
